THE speed limit for part of an A road will be cut after the county council gave its approval.

A stretch of the A415 between Abingdon and Culham will be reduced to 40mph from the national speed limit.

Thames Valley Police said they were opposed to the change and could see no justification for the reduction.

Culham Parish Council said it initially wanted a 30mph speed limit.

The county council gave the 40mph change the go-ahead yesterday after saying 30mph would have been against national policy.
